.datepickr-wrapper {
    display: inline;
    position: relative;
}

.datepickr-calendar {
	font-family: 'Trebuchet MS', Tahoma, Verdana, Arial, sans-serif;
	font-size: 12px;
	background-color: #fff;
	color: #000;
	border: 1px solid #c6c7c9;
	padding: 10px;
	display: none;
	position: absolute;
    top: 100%;
	left: 0;
	z-index: 100;
	margin-top: 10px;
}

.open .datepickr-calendar {
    display: block;
}

.datepickr-calendar .datepickr-months {
	/* background-color: #1B2C56;
	border: 1px solid #1B2C56; */
	color: #000;
	padding: 2px;
	text-align: center;
    font-size: 120%;
}

.datepickr-calendar .datepickr-prev-month,
.datepickr-calendar .datepickr-next-month {
	color: #000;
	text-decoration: none;
	padding: 0 .4em;
	cursor: pointer;
}

.datepickr-calendar .datepickr-prev-month {
	float: left;
}

.datepickr-calendar .datepickr-next-month {
	float: right;
}

.datepickr-calendar .datepickr-current-month {
	padding: 0 .5em;
}

.datepickr-calendar .datepickr-prev-month:hover,
.datepickr-calendar .datepickr-next-month:hover {
	background-color: #256EC1;
	color: #fff;
}

.datepickr-calendar table {
	border-collapse: collapse;
	padding: 10px;
	width: 100%;
}

.datepickr-calendar thead {
    font-size: 90%;
}

.datepickr-calendar tr {
	padding-top: 5px;
	padding-bottom: 5px;
}

.datepickr-calendar th,
.datepickr-calendar td {
    width: 14.3%;
}

.datepickr-calendar th {
	text-align: center;
    padding: 5px;
}

.datepickr-calendar td {
	text-align: right;
	padding: 1px;
}

.datepickr-calendar .datepickr-day {
	display: block;
	color: #000;
	/* background-color: #f6f6f6;
	border: 1px solid #ccc; */
	padding: 5px;
	cursor: pointer;
}

.datepickr-calendar .datepickr-day:hover {
	color: #fff;
	background-color: #256EC1;
	/* border: 1px solid #fbcb09; */
}

.datepickr-calendar .today .datepickr-day {
	background-color: #1B2C56;
	/* border: 1px solid #fed22f; */
	color: #fff;
}

.datepickr-calendar .selected .datepickr-day {
	background-color: #256EC1;
	color: #f6f6f6;
}

.datepickr-calendar .disabled .datepickr-day,
.datepickr-calendar .disabled .datepickr-day:hover {
    background-color: #eee;
    border: 1px dotted #ccc;
    color: #bbb;
    cursor: default;
}
